Measurements of protein-protein interactions by size exclusion chromatography.

A method is presented for determining second virial coefficients (B(2)) of protein solutions from retention time measurements in size exclusion chromatography. We determine B(2) by analyzing the concentration dependence of the chromatographic partition coefficient. Size Exclusion Chromatography of Polymers

In the characterization of polymers, size-exclusion chromatography (SEC) has become a standard technique for determining molar mass averages andmolar mass distributions (MMD) of polymers. A Deadenylase Assay by Size-Exclusion Chromatography

The shortening of the 3'-end poly(A) tail, also called deadenylation, is crucial to the regulation of mRNA processing, transportation, translation and degradation. The deadenylation process is achieved by deadenylases, which specifically catalyze the removal of the poly(A) tail at the 3'-end of eukaryotic mRNAs and release 5'-AMP as the product.
